Lee’s manic energy, uncanny observations, hilarious delivery and side-splitting material have made his live performances a must-see for comedy fans. His tours and DVD releases year-on-year continue to smash sales and box office records. Last year’s 59 date arena tour ‘Big’ saw Lee sell out his first show at London’s 02 Arena in just one hour, making it the UK’s biggest solo live comedy gig ever. This broke Lee’s own previous record from 2005 at the MEN arena where he played to over 10,000 people.

Dazzling comic genius Lee Evans released his new DVD earlier this week (Mon 16th November). Access All Arenas gives fans the chance to see the best and most hilarious moments taken from Lee’s previous three arena tour DVD’s including Wired & Wonderful - Live At Wembley (2002), XL Tour Live (2005) and the record-breaking Big - Live At The 02 (2008).  New and exclusive to Access All Arenas are some very special DVD extra’s including a unique personal appearance from Lee plus a brand new in-depth interview with Lee by Phill Jupitus.

On hand to guide you through Access All Arenas is the man himself, as Lee gives a very special personal introduction as he presents his favourite observational routines on everyday life from the three arena tours -  including families, holidays, sport and of course “the missus“! Using state-of-the-art computer graphics, Lee welcomes and bids farewell to viewers in his own unique way making Access All Arenas an essential must-have for any Lee Evans fan.
